答案 0 :(得分:16)
你有两个选择:
1)直截了当,下载Xcode 9,你就可以了。
2)您需要将iOS 11的DeveloperDiskImage
放入
/Applications/Xcode8.app/Contents/Developer/Platforms/iPhoneOS.platform/DeviceSupport
你可以在Xcode9中以相同的路径找到这个diskImage,以防你想继续使用XCode8
iOS 11磁盘映像的路径:
〜/应用/ Xcode9.app /内容/开发商/平台/ iPhoneOS.platform / DeviceSupport / 11.0
NOTE: Xcode 9.0 requires a Mac running macOS Sierra 10.12.4 or later.
答案 1 :(得分:9)
最多可以使用iOS 12.1
您可以下载DeveloperDiskImage.dmg here或here
步骤:
1.下载Zip文件并解压缩。
2.点击" Finder"在MAC OS中
3.点击"转到文件夹"
4.Paste /Applications/Xcode.app/Contents/Developer/Platforms/iPhoneOS.platform/DeviceSupport。否则,请转到应用程序>右键单击Xcode>显示包装内容并按照上面的目录。
5.Reboot Device + Xcode + Mac
答案 2 :(得分:1)
软件不再安装的原因之一,例如您无法安装Sierra或Xcode 9更多地与Apple有关,使您的计算机过时。
这是最近的(2016 Addition to machines no longer supported by Apple),并且有很多惊喜。
我有一个完美运行的iMac 2008年初,2年前它被放在了过时的清单上。我无法再更新某些程序,例如安装Sierra或Xcode 9.2。
有些非常心怀不满的人购买了MacBooks,Apple甚至没有引入升级版机器来取代MacBook,而是让它们过时了。
现在,如果我想在新的iOS 11操作系统上运行我的应用程序,我需要更换一台完美且运行良好的机器。那是不对的。
答案 3 :(得分:-1)
您无法在Xcode 8.2上运行ios 11
您需要Xcode 9 beta
https://developer.apple.com/download/
Xcode 9 beta需要Mac运行macOS 10.12.4或更高版本。 Xcode 9 beta包括适用于iOS 11,watchOS 4,macOS 10.13和tvOS 11的SDK